Transaction 084198b39bdd441571c7d8d181b1c8640e9bf03c0437c2d5724ef45977cda112

7 Input
2 Outputs
  • 084198b39bdd441571c7d8d181b1c8640e9bf03c0437c2d5724ef45977cda112:0
  • value  17964397
    address  16W5aZenU6E1wgEN5XFmQ9zmSo3yvvveED
  • 084198b39bdd441571c7d8d181b1c8640e9bf03c0437c2d5724ef45977cda112:1
  • value  18004655
    address  3MPKqy7wsYwYU5fhNby2PgP7rWBEdvjaVm